Understanding Artificial Intelligence

Artificial Intelligence refers to computer systems designed to perform tasks that normally require human intelligence. These tasks include learning from information, analyzing data, solving problems, recognizing patterns, and making decisions.

Modern AI systems can recognize images, understand spoken or written language, and interact with users in a conversational way. They can also learn from new data and improve their responses over time.

In some situations, AI systems can even operate independently. Self-driving vehicles, for example, rely heavily on AI to analyze their surroundings and make driving decisions without constant human input.

Key Forms of AI Used in Education

Artificial Intelligence in education combines knowledge from several disciplines such as computer science, psychology, linguistics, mathematics, and statistics. By combining insights from these fields, AI tools can support both teachers and students in meaningful ways.

Machine Learning

Machine learning is one of the most widely used branches of AI. It allows systems to analyze large amounts of data and identify patterns that help predict student needs.

Educational platforms use machine learning to track student progress, recommend learning materials, and adjust lessons based on individual performance. Technologies related to machine learning include speech recognition, natural language processing, neural networks, and deep learning.

These systems can evaluate how students interact with learning materials and adapt the content accordingly, making the learning experience more personalized.

AI-Powered Chat Systems

AI chat assistants are increasingly being used by schools, colleges, and universities to handle student inquiries. Instead of requiring staff members to respond to every question, AI chatbots can answer many common queries automatically.

These virtual assistants can guide students toward useful resources, explain application processes, and provide quick responses outside office hours. When more complex issues arise, the system can transfer the conversation to a staff member or provide a summary for further assistance.

This technology helps institutions provide continuous support while reducing the workload on administrative staff.

Advantages of AI in Education

AI tools are beginning to play an important role in improving the overall learning environment. They help teachers manage tasks efficiently while giving students more engaging and responsive educational experiences.

Personalized Learning

One of the biggest advantages of AI is the ability to create individualized learning experiences. AI systems can adjust lesson difficulty, recommend additional resources, and provide customized feedback based on each student’s performance.

This approach allows students to learn at their own pace while ensuring they fully understand key concepts.

Reduced Administrative Work for Teachers

Teachers often spend a large portion of their time preparing materials, grading assignments, and organizing classroom activities. AI tools can help automate tasks such as creating quizzes, summarizing information, and generating draft lesson plans.

By reducing routine work, teachers can dedicate more time to mentoring students and improving classroom engagement.

Instant Feedback for Students

Traditional education sometimes requires students to wait days or weeks to receive feedback on their work. AI-powered learning tools can provide immediate responses, allowing students to correct mistakes and improve their understanding quickly.

This rapid feedback encourages continuous learning and builds student confidence.

Improved Accessibility

AI can also make education more inclusive. Features such as real-time translation, speech-to-text tools, captions, and vocabulary support help students with different learning needs access the same educational materials.

These tools allow more students to participate actively in lessons without constant assistance.

Better Use of Data

Educational institutions generate large amounts of data related to student performance and classroom activities. AI systems can analyze this information to identify patterns that might otherwise go unnoticed.

By spotting early warning signs of academic difficulties, teachers and administrators can intervene sooner and provide targeted support.

The Future of AI in Education

The role of AI in education is expected to expand significantly in the coming years. New developments are already pointing toward more advanced learning environments.

Adaptive Learning Paths: AI will continue to monitor student performance in real time, adjusting lessons to fill knowledge gaps and support struggling learners.

Teacher Support Tools: Administrative tasks such as grading, scheduling, and data analysis will increasingly be handled by AI systems, allowing educators to focus on teaching and mentoring.

24/7 AI Tutors: Intelligent tutoring systems will provide students with continuous assistance, offering explanations and practice exercises whenever they need help.

Generative AI in the Classroom: Teachers and students are already using AI to generate ideas, summarize information, and create learning materials more efficiently.
